JAMMU, Feb 24: Deputy Commissioner Jammu Ajeet Kumar Sahu who is also the Chairman of District Red Cross Society (DRCS), Jammu today inaugurated three days workshop on extension of Red Cross / CHILDLINE activities for Ambassadors (students) & counsellors ( Teachers ) of educational institutions. The workshop was organized by Indian Red Cross Society, District Branch Jammu with an objective to make Counsellors & Ambassadors aware about First Aid, use of Fire extinguishers, Water sanitation, hygiene, Right to vote, Human values, Service to Humanity and above all What Red Cross is and its functioning so as to make other people aware of these activities for alleviation of human sufferings. Suresh Sharma Executive Secretary, DRCS, Jammu welcomed the Chief Guest, distinguished guests and the participants from different educational institutions. Speaking on the occasion, Ajeet Kumar Sahu briefed the participants about Red Cross and Civil Defence, about its humanitarian endeavours, Right to vote, Water sanitation, hygiene and asked the gathering to do their little bit of humanitarian services.
